Things You'll Need:
- You will need your self, your baby, and to be relaxed with a happy clear voice. Also, daily experiences. Simple toys, simple baby board books, or sturdy picture cards.
-
Step 1
Remember to talk while you are doing simple tasks. Talk in a clear, sweet voice. Not so much goo goo ga ga. Make it fun such as there goes you sock. Then make a noise such as . . . boop. Then smile!
-
Step 2
While playing, sitting on the floor, gives you optimum eye contact. This is very important. Talk about the toys, as you play. What does the toy do? Does it go around and around? Talk about the colors the he sees.
-
Step 3
Most importantly, have fun, and relax. Hug and kiss your babies cheeks. Tell her how much you love her. When your baby feels loved. She will have the most confidence in herself. Confidence will help her to talk.
